Dick Gerrits is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Dick Gerrits has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 220 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Surgery, 5 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 1 paper in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Dick Gerrits's work include Abdominal vascular conditions and treatments (4 papers), Renal and Vascular Pathologies (2 papers) and Esophageal and GI Pathology (2 papers). Dick Gerrits is often cited by papers focused on Abdominal vascular conditions and treatments (4 papers), Renal and Vascular Pathologies (2 papers) and Esophageal and GI Pathology (2 papers). Dick Gerrits coll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ands. Dick Gerrits's co-authors include Gerrit Wolters‐Eisfeld, R. van Schilfgaarde, W.M. Fritschy, Jeroen J. Kolkman, Robert H. Geelkerken, R. Meerwaldt, Marjolein Brusse‐Keizer, A. B. Huisman, A.S. van Petersen and Peter Mensink and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Vascular Surgery, European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ery and Netherlands Heart Journal.

All Works

7 of 7 papers shown
1.
Petersen, A.S. van, Jeroen J. Kolkman, Dick Gerrits, et al.. (2017). Clinical significance of mesenteric arterial collateral circulation in patients with celiac artery compression syndrome. Journal of Vascular Surgery. 65(5). 1366–1374. 23 indexed citations
2.
Meerwaldt, R., et al.. (2014). Retrograde open mesenteric stenting for acute mesenteric ischemia. Journal of Vascular Surgery. 60(3). 726–734. 48 indexed citations
3.
Meerwaldt, R., et al.. (2013). Superior Two-year Results of Externally Unsupported Polyester Compared to Supported Grafts in Above-knee Bypass Grafting: A Multicenter Randomised Trial. European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ery. 45(3). 275–281. 3 indexed citations
4.
Said, Shreef, K. Gert van Houwelingen, Dick Gerrits, et al.. (2011). Diagnostic and therapeutic approach of congenital solitary coronary artery fistulas in adults: Dutch case series and review of literature. Netherlands Heart Journal. 19(4). 183–191. 18 indexed citations
5.
Wanroij, J.L. van, A.S. van Petersen, A. B. Huisman, et al.. (2004). Endovascular Treatment of Chronic Splanchnic Syndrome. European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ery. 28(2). 193–200. 23 indexed citations
6.
Huisman, A. B., et al.. (2004). Endovascular Treatment of Chronic Splanchnic Syndrome. European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ery. 28(2). 193–200. 8 indexed citations
7.
Wolters‐Eisfeld, Gerrit, W.M. Fritschy, Dick Gerrits, & R. van Schilfgaarde. (1992). A versatile alginate droplet generator applicable for microencapsulation of pancreatic islets. Journal of Applied Biomaterials. 3(4). 281–286. 97 indexed citations
